Output 38ad17e60106e02c35f89c62780aafa6434fce84861eefda346a645d34532d71:1

value
1640000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 188a7a71017a1f47fcd10e4fdb92aee29bf0340f OP_EQUAL
address
9tg2mdi5cazR1ruvEugwDYbERdmBPuuv4q
transaction
38ad17e60106e02c35f89c62780aafa6434fce84861eefda346a645d34532d71